VICTOR GAUNTLETT, who died recently at age 60, was a hero of the British motor industry. Gauntlett bought Aston Martin in 1981 and ran the tiny company in Newport Pagnell until selling a controlling interest to Ford in 1987. He eventually sold all of Aston to Ford, but stayed on as chairman until 1991.

Gauntlett deserves great credit for keeping Aston alive during those six years; eventually bringing out a new Virage - the first new Aston in 20 years.
